Summary/Abstract: In Poland 30% of healthcare expenditures are directly covered by households. This high fraction has a negative impact on households’ socioeconomic status. Analysing current and future individual expenditures on healthcare becomes crucial and microsimulation may be useful for forecasting health economic variables. The purpose for this research is to apply a microsimulation experiment to analyse direct healthcare expenditures of households in Poland in years 2009-2018. Obtained results are used to perform a spatial and dynamic analysis of ambulatory and pharmaceutical expenditures.
